Как создать строку в программировании?
Строковое значение – это последовательность символов, которая может содержать буквы, цифры, знаки препинания и другие специальные символы. В программировании есть различные способы создания строк.
1. Литералы строк
Самый простой способ создать строку в программировании ー использовать литералы строк. Литералы строк заключаются в кавычки (одинарные или двойные) и могут содержать любые символы.
Например⁚
var str ″Пример строки″;
Для строк, содержащих специальные символы, такие как кавычки или символы новой строки, можно использовать экранирование.
Например⁚
var str ″Он сказал⁚ \″Привет!\″″;
2. Конкатенация строк
Конкатенация строк ౼ это процесс объединения нескольких строк в одну. В большинстве языков программирования для конкатенации используется оператор ″ ″ (плюс).
Например⁚
var str1 ″Привет,″;
var str2 ″Мир!″;
var result str1 ″ ″ str2;
Результатом будет строка ″Привет, Мир!″.
3. Работа с подстроками
Подстрока ー это часть строки, обрезанная по определенным индексам. В большинстве языков программирования есть функции или методы для работы с подстроками.
Например, в JavaScript можно использовать метод substring
⁚
var str ″Пример строки″;
var sub str.substring(0, 7);
Результатом будет подстрока ″Пример″.
4. Пустая строка
Пустая строка ౼ это строка без символов. Она может быть полезна в некоторых случаях, например, для инициализации переменной или для проверки, является ли строка пустой.
Например⁚
var str ″″; // пустая строка
if (str ″″) {
console.log(″Строка пустая″);
}
5. Цитата
Цитата ౼ это строка, содержащая слова или фразы, заключенные в кавычки. Для создания такой строки можно использовать разные виды кавычек ౼ одинарные или двойные.
Например⁚
var quote 'Все начинается с мечты';
или
var quote ″Все начинается с мечты″;
Обратите внимание, что если внутри цитаты используются кавычки, можно использовать экранирование, как было показано выше.
Создание и работа со строками является важной частью программирования. Знание синтаксиса и использование операций конкатенации, подстрок и других методов позволяют эффективно манипулировать строковыми значениями и создавать разнообразные текстовые выражения.